A vintage 8mm home movie clip from 1964 captures a quiet church area in Racine, Wisconsin, showcasing a prominent white statue surrounded by greenery and a peaceful neighborhood setting. The footage reflects mid-century Americana with a nostalgic tone, highlighting religious architecture and community life.
